These pumpkin bars are something my family have made ever since I was little. I believe the recipe was passed down from my Grandpa. The pumpkin bars turn out like a dense moist pumpkin cake texture. They are sooo delicious and soft. They would be good even without the cream cheese frosting on top. These are my favorite thing to make with pumpkin and they are super easy! This recipe makes 1 standard 9×13 pan’s worth of pumpkin bars but I usually double it which works nicely if you buy one of the large cans of pumpkin (~29 oz) and a full 8oz cream cheese package. I usually store the leftovers in the refrigerator so the cream cheese icing holds up better.
